| Reverse description | Three upright assegai spears, their shafts bound and tapering to fine points, are displayed centrally in the field, designed by George Kruger Gray whose initials KG appear at the base. The denomination 3d is prominently positioned at the top between the spear heads, while the date flanks the shafts at centre left and right. The circular legend SOUTHERN RHODESIA runs around the periphery, divided by the spear composition, with a milled border enclosing the design. |
